How Companies Can Use Photosharing CorrectlyOctober 27

Nikon looked through Flickr, picked out a few great photographers, and sent them D80s, which is a really nice DSLR. They then used the photos they shot in a few advertisements and created a Flash website detailing each of the photographers, who range from rank amateurs to professional snappers.

Flickr gets some recognition as a incubator of talent, Nikon gets some good will, and cool photographers get nice cameras.
